This is the SystemC Live CD Download page.

The standard SystemC Live distribution is aimed at users wanting to run a SystemC development environment on a medium to low spec machine (read Pentium II and higher).Like all Live CD distribution the SystemC Live will run off your computer’s RAM. Consequently you will have to have a reasonable amount of memory (128 MB) to run it.

This distribution is also streamlined enough to be run in a virtual environment such as VMWare player or QEMU. That is providing you are running it on a recent machine with 512 to 1024 MB of memory.

The detailed description of the standard SystemC Live distribution is as follows:

  • SystemC 2.2 beta
  • SCV 1.0
  • TLM 1.0
  • SystemC / C++ tutorial (Esperan)
  • gcc g++ 3.4.6
  • gdb 6.3
  • ddd 3.3.9
  • gtkwave 1.3.79
  • vim 7.0
  • geany 0.7.1
  • opera 9.02
  • Beep Media Player 0.9.7
  • xpdf
  • xfce4 4.2.3.2
  • slapt-get 0.9.11b
  • gslapt 0.3.1.2
